Portrait Paulus GyAongyAosi Hungarian doctor
Portrait of Paulus Gyongyosi, The Hungarian doctor and literary scholar Paulus Gyngyssi, writing with a goose feather, sitting behind a desk. Gyongyosi looks to the left, with his finger raised. Below the portrait, under his name and titles, there are four lines of text, entirely in Latin. Paulus Gyongyosi, Christian Friedrich Fritzsch (mentioned on object), Amsterdam, 1753, paper, engraving, h 291 mm × w 201 mm
